West Virginia GED Information
Cost for GED Testing in West Virginia
The GED testing services through the State of West
Virginia are free.
There is no cost to take the GED test in West Virginia if
applicants meet certain
guidelines.
GED Residency for West Virginia
West Virginia does not have a residency requirement. Persons meeting all criteria and
demonstrating
themselves eligible under the State of West Virginia GED
Diploma guidelines shall be admitted to GED testing for the purpose of securing
a State of West Virginia GED Diploma.
Age Requirements for West Virginia
Nineteen and older
If you are
nineteen (19) years of age or older or re-testing, you may proceed to
STEP 3.
Eighteen (18)
Years of Age
An individual who is eighteen (18) years of age is
eligible to test by qualifying under any of the following categories:
1. Provides evidence on the WV GED Form (Appendix 1) that candidateÂ’s
original high school class has graduated, the candidateÂ’s withdrawal date, passing OPT scores, and release of information signature,or
2. Provides evidence on the WV GED Form (Appendix 1) the withdrawal
date from a regular accredited high school, passing OPT scores, and
release of information signature.
Sixteen (16) Years
of Age and Seventeen (17) Years of Age An
individual who is sixteen (16) or seventeen (17) years of
age is
eligible to test by qualifying under any of the following
categories:
3. Provides evidence on the WV GED Form (Appendix 1) that candidateÂ’s
original high school class has graduated, the candidateÂ’s withdrawal date, parent or guardian signature granting permission to test, passing
OPT scores, and release of information signature. or
4.Provides evidence on the WV GED Form (Appendix 1) the withdrawal
date, which reflects that the candidate was withdrawn from the
regular accredited high school or was placed in alternative education or
home-schooled for at least one (1) month prior to testing date, parent or
guardian signature granting permission to test, passing OPT
scores, and release of information signature.
